Anyhow - when I last updated this thread about the noisy Carbotech's on the driver front (https://www.corvetteforum.com/forums...-new-pads.html)... I had again pulled both front wheels - pulled the pads - touched them to a belt sander to remove the glazing... and this time when I replaced things I swapped inside pad for outside pad... AND side to side... i.e. driver inside went to passenger outside, etc etc. I put everything back together and reset the trip meter since it has consistently taken about 140 miles for the swish-swish-swish to return...
Closer to 400 miles and both sides remain silent.
So either - I finished lifting race compounds off the rotors and it "just got silent" - or - there is something about the pad / rotor matchup on the driver side that was just "unhappy" and moving things around solved it... I dunno... but case solved.
